Homelessness is a significant problem in the United States. According to the National Alliance to End Homelessness’ 2021 State of Homelessness report , there were 580,466 people in the United States who were experiencing homelessness in 2020, 30% of which were families with children. Chronic Homelessness Artificial Intelligence model (CHAI) . Launched in August by a local government social service agency in Canada, the AI system analyzes the personal data of participants to calculate who is likely to have nowhere to sleep for an extended period.
